Transaction 595f63d4cc71e51bd869bf3e0c26066b40e7125d853145adf2ebe4e588fce7b2

1 Input
2 Outputs
  • 595f63d4cc71e51bd869bf3e0c26066b40e7125d853145adf2ebe4e588fce7b2:0
  • value  5722000
    address  12W2Q9qoTw2NNMGxUZ4hmPmGfk7NFQ2wnq
  • 595f63d4cc71e51bd869bf3e0c26066b40e7125d853145adf2ebe4e588fce7b2:1
  • value  382659709
    address  bc1qnsupj8eqya02nm8v6tmk93zslu2e2z8chlmcej